I'm looking for a 30 minute hands-on activity to follow up a science
show about "Air" for students aged 6 - 8 years.  Some of the concepts
that are covered in the show are:  Air takes up space, we can feel
moving air, sometimes we can see air, sound travels through air, some
things in air smell, hot air rises and air is made up of different
things.  Any suggestions for activities would be much appreciated.
